Major requirements
The major program in sociology requires 10 courses and must include:
SOC 190 Self and Society
SOC 272 Analyzing Social Trends
or MATH 141 Introductory Statistics
SOC 301 Sociological Theory
SOC 302 Research Methods in Sociology
SOC 402 Senior Seminar
or SOC 403 Senior Pro-seminar
Students are expected to take SOC 190 in their freshman or sophomore year, SOC 301 and SOC 302 in their junior year and SOC 402 or SOC 403 in their senior year. Students must also take SOC 272 or MATH 141.
